When booked initially, the reservation was for the Hard Rock Hotel. About a week and a half before I arrived, NYX acquired the building. We received no notification about this from either business. The hotel was slightly outdated and undergoing the beginnings of redecoration. The staff seemed to either be hired by NYX and unfamiliar with the hotel or previous employees who were unfamiliar with the new management’s policies. For example, the manual chain lock on my door had been disabled in both of our rooms and the staff at the desk didn’t seem to understand how it had happened. They did move me to a room with a working manual lock immediately, but didn’t seem to understand why I felt the need for one as a single woman in the room and assured me that the staff would respect my privacy. The person in the other room in our booking also had his disabled but didn’t want to bother moving. The next day, housekeeping barged into his room without waiting for an answer to her knock. The person inside was just finishing dressing.
Other than that, it’s just little things that haven’t yet been worked out in the management change. For example their card scanners in the rooms and elevators seem to be new and still finicky, and the person at reception hadn’t read the laundry policy on the NYX laundry slips in the rooms. The slips specified it would be back by 6pm if picked up by 8am, but she said it might be the next day. She also had me bring the laundry down to the reception desk when the slip said it would be picked up. The staff was actually really great and when I pointed it out I did get same day laundry; it seemed like a new management miscommunication.
Overall, I’d recommend staying here after they’ve had a chance to settle and remodel.
